Output 52528ba8988cf84c2c5408fb4b26ac1973da4e0b2f449a53297df7ff8f0f0dec:2

value
70942
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c7eebb17711e50383826fac8d01be9f45495ee3 OP_EQUAL
address
38fVKj4navVQzxv4riMF6yhKBZcK2P2ngy
transaction
52528ba8988cf84c2c5408fb4b26ac1973da4e0b2f449a53297df7ff8f0f0dec
spent
true